About The Role:

CrowdStrike is looking for individuals across the industry to add their passion and experience in helping customers realize better security outcomes with log management and advanced data analytics.

As an Associate Consultant on the Platform Professional Services team focusing on Falcon Next-Gen SIEM, you’ll work solo and with other CrowdStrike consultants to become a trusted advisor to customers by answering technical questions, demonstrating Next-Gen SIEM capabilities, and laying out a technical vision of a Next-Gen SIEM roadmap for customers to follow. Working alongside other Falcon engineers and other cross functional teams, you’ll be a critical part of operationalizing Next-Gen SIEM within customer environments. You’ll work with the customer as they discover what Falcon NGSIEM can do for them, help expand their use cases, and provide feedback timely to CrowdStrike Product Management teams. Simultaneously you’ll develop internal relationships to partner with key stakeholders to influence product enhancements that will meet customer needs.

The position is remote-friendly within the United States with the opportunity for limited travel onsite with customers.

What You'll Do:
• Work with other CrowdStrike Professional Services consultants and independently providing best-in-class delivery and integration services to a wide range of organizations and verticals
• Act a trusted advisor to help lead customers to mature outcomes using next generation SIEM, log management, AI assisted investigations and SOAR features and functionality
• Provide knowledge transfer of Falcon Next-Gen and other relevant Falcon modules to our customers

What You'll Need:
• We’re looking for a colleague with a great compassion for taking care of customers and their challenges combined with well-rounded technical, analytical, and customer service skills. We want someone who appreciates the importance of teamwork but will also benefit from your proactive approach to solving challenges and helping external and internal parties.
• Fundamental/academic understanding of common Information Security principles and standards
• 2+ years of experience working with log management/SIEM solutions (e..g, Falcon Next-Gen SIEM, Splunk, Chronicle, Exabeam, QRadar, Sumo Logic, etc) and SOAR (e.g., CrowdStrike Fusion, Palo Alto XSOAR, Splunk SOAR, Tines, Swimlane etc.) in a Security Operations role, a consulting role or similar capacity
• Knowledge of skills and best practices related to log analysis, data onboarding, parsing, developing searches, dashboards, and reviewing alerts within an information security analysis/investigation tool
• Experience (1+ years) knowledge of common cloud providers and their services such as AWS, GCP, and Azure, including hands on configuration of policies and integrations with applications
• Experience (2+ years) knowledge of supporting traditional IT Security functions such as directory services, authentication, networking, data storage, endpoint security
• Experience using an AI platform for development of integrations, synthesis of security data, assisting with code reviews
• Experience developing documentation to internal stakeholders and external parties as necessaryOccasional travel may be required (
• Strong problem-solving, written and oral communication skills in English
